If you can find a 7900 GTO, then that's your best for your bang card. It's basically a 7900 GTX with slower memory frequency. Considering its price, it's well worth it.
If you don't care if it's NVIDIA or ATI, you can also look at ATI's X1950 XT, which is around that price also. Both are excellent cards, considering how much they cost.
